OVA: The Secret Sauce of Anime
OVA stands for Original Video Animation. In Japan, they sometimes call it OAV (Original Anime Video). Basically, these are anime episodes or series that skip the TV broadcast.
Instead of hitting your screens weekly, they go straight to home video. We're talking VHS back in the day, now Blu-ray, streaming, and digital downloads!
Why Are OVAs So Awesome?
OVAs give creators more freedom. They don't have to worry as much about network censors or strict episode lengths.
This means OVAs can be edgier, more experimental, or just plain weird. Think of them as the director's cut of your favorite anime!
They often explore side stories or delve deeper into character backstories. Ever wonder what happened *before* the main plot of your favorite anime? An OVA might hold the answer.
More Bang for Your Buck (Usually!)
OVA productions often have higher budgets than regular TV anime. More budget often means slicker animation and more detailed art.
Expect breathtaking fight scenes and visuals that will blow your mind! Studios often use OVAs to showcase their best animation chops.
This is not always true of course. Some are low budget.
The OVA Variety Pack
You can find OVAs in virtually every anime genre. Action, romance, horror, comedy - you name it, there's probably an OVA for it.
They might be a single, self-contained episode. Or they could be a mini-series of a few episodes, giving you a more complete story arc.
Sometimes, OVAs act as sequels or prequels to popular TV anime. These can be essential viewing for hardcore fans wanting the full experience.
How to Spot an OVA
Usually, the packaging or description will say "OVA". Look for terms like "Original Video Animation" or "Direct-to-video".
Also, check the episode count. If it's a short series outside the main anime's run, it's highly likely an OVA.
Dive into some online anime databases. These usually have lists of OVAs associated with different series.

Examples to Get You Hooked
Need some starting points? Check out classic OVAs like "Gunbuster" for amazing mecha action. Or "Rurouni Kenshin: Trust & Betrayal" for a darker, more dramatic take on the samurai story.
Don't forget "Bubblegum Crisis", a cyberpunk classic with killer music. These are just the tip of the iceberg!
